Standards, Benchmarks, and Data Integrity

The NAPLAN 2026 assessment cycle maintains the rigorous four-proficiency standard introduced in previous years: Exceeding, Strong, Developing, and Needs Additional Support. Unlike historical numerical scores, these proficiency levels aim to provide a more descriptive understanding of student growth in numeracy, reading, writing, spelling, grammar, and punctuation.

For the 2026 cycle, ACARA has placed increased emphasis on the "Learning Progression" framework. This approach ensures that schools are not merely looking at a snapshot of test-day performance, but are instead aligning results with long-term curriculum milestones. Educators remain under strict directives to interpret these results within the broader context of classroom performance and formative assessments conducted throughout the 2026 academic year. Accessing Student Reports and Comparative Data

Parents and guardians should anticipate receiving individual student reports via their respective school portals or direct physical mail within the coming weeks. For many states, the digital release occurs in tandem with the physical distribution to ensure consistent communication across systems.

Once the individual reports are released, the My School website is scheduled to update its database to include the 2026 figures. This platform remains the primary resource for comparing school-level performance against statistically similar schools across the nation. For parents looking to analyze trends, the website offers:



  • Performance Benchmarks: Comparison against the national average for Year 3, 5, 7, and 9 cohorts.
  • Trend Analysis: A longitudinal view of school performance dating back to the program’s inception.
  • School Profile Data: Contextual information regarding student backgrounds and enrollment statistics.

If you have not received your child's report by the end of August, it is recommended that you contact the school administration directly, as they are the primary gatekeepers of student-specific data during the initial rollout phase.
